Definitions
- the subject of the present invention is an installation for producing hot water or steam, such as a fogging apparatus for bakery ovens, a water heater, a percolator, or any other domestic or industrial installation using steam or hot water.
- a self-descaling process is known from FR-A-1 112473. It is also possible to largely avoid scaling of the installation by providing, upstream of the latter, a water softener , but in this case, on the one hand, we must face the costs represented by the periodic replacement of the ion exchange resin and, on the other hand, we supply the installation for producing hot water or steam with water whose pH has been changed.
- the object of the present invention is to remedy these drawbacks by proposing a self-descaling installation which requires no user intervention, no energy input, no chemical product and which is simple and economical.
- the present invention applies to installations of the type comprising a source of cold water, means for controlling the flow of cold water from said source to a receiver, a receiver heated by suitable means and means for producing hot water or steam supplied with water via said receiver, said receiver further comprising means for evacuation to the sewer, the part of the installation upstream of all heating means being called “ cold zone "(Zf) and the part of the installation downstream of said receiver being called” hot zone "(Zc).
- the object of the invention is achieved in that it offers an installation characterized in that it comprises in the hot zone, a chamber opening on the one hand into said production zone and, on the other hand , in the sewer and in that the supply line has, in the cold zone, immediately downstream of the control means, a bypass opening into the sewer.
- the evacuation (s) in the sewer are advantageously open permanently, the flow rate of the evacuation not being significant with respect to the flow rate towards the production area.
- the evacuation to the sewer of the chamber is done by a tube whose evacuation opening is raised relative to the bottom of the chamber.
- the chamber contains, opposite its water inlet, a jet breaker capable of storing calories when the chamber is empty and of returning them to the water when the latter is readmitted into said bedroom.

- the installation includes a cold zone Zf and a hot zone Zc.
- the term “cold zone” is intended to mean a zone in which the temperature is between ambient temperature and about 35 ° C.
- a valve 3 controlling the flow of water in the pipe 1 and a bypass 4 joining line 1 to a line 5 for evacuation to the sewer.
- a chamber 6 is interposed, in the hot zone, between the pipe 1 and the steam production zone 2.
- This chamber 6 is mounted against the wall of the furnace (not shown) by appropriate fixing means 7.
- the chamber 6 comprises a water inlet pipe 8, a water outlet pipe 9 extending by a pipe 10, the end of which forms a water spray nozzle, and a pipe 11 joined to a bypass 12 opening into the pipe d 'evacuation to the sewer 5.
- the pipe 11 projects inside the chamber 6, which has the effect of maintaining a tank bottom 13 as best seen in FIG. 2.
- a jet breaker 14 is provided directly above the water inlet pipe 8 in the chamber 6.
- the diameter of the branches 4 and 12 is much smaller than that of the pipe 9, so that the leaks towards the sewer are not significant compared to the flow of water injected into the zone of steam production 2
- valve 3 When it is desired to produce steam, the valve 3 is opened so that the water is conveyed through line 1 into the chamber 6 from which it emerges through line 10 to be sprayed by the nozzle in the production zone steam 2. A minor amount of water escapes towards the sewer by diversions 4 and 12.
- the valve 3 When it is desired to interrupt the production of steam, the valve 3 is closed, so that a large part of the water contained in the pipe 1, in the area between the valve 3 and the bypass 4, escapes by this bypass to the evacuation pipe to the sewer 5, while the rest of the water contained in the pipe 1 downstream of the valve 3 and the water contained in the chamber 6 flows by the bypass 12 towards the evacuation pipe to the sewer 5.
- the bypass 4 When the bypass 4 is empty, air enters the circuit from the pipe 5, which has the effect of facilitating the emptying of the chamber 6 and cooling the valve 3.
- the chamber 6 empties quickly and the liquid film remaining on its walls evaporates instantly.
- the mineral salts contained in this liquid film are deposited on the walls of the chamber 6 in the form of a thin film of unstructured tartar.
- the particles of tartar resting on the bottom are swept away by the turbulence created during the re-admission of water and evacuated like those which come from the deposit of tartar on the other walls of the tank.
- the hot water does not remain in any part of the installation, a stay which promotes the formation of structured tartar strongly adhering to the walls.
- the hot water is periodically and rapidly removed, which only allows the formation of an unstructured tartar film easily removable by thermal shock and turbulence.
- the invention is applicable both to an installation for the discontinuous production of hot water or steam and to an installation for continuous production, as shown in FIG. 3, where the same components are designated by the same references as 'in Figure 1 but accompanied by the prime or second signs.
- Reference 15 designates a timer actuation mechanism alternately actuating the valves 3 'and 3 ". It is understood that, when the mechanism 15 opens the valve 3', the water enters the chamber 6 'and flows through the line 10 'to the steam production zone 2. When the mechanism 15 closes the valve 3' and opens the valve 3 ", the water enters the chamber 6" and flows through the line 10 "to the steam production 2. In this way, steam is produced continuously in zone 2 while the periodic and alternative interruption of the flow of water in the 6 'and 6 "chambers and the periodic and alternative restoration of this flow in said chambers give the self-scaling effect described in detail with reference to FIGS. 1 and 2.
- the communication between the pipe 1 and the pipe 5, by branch 4, may not be open permanently, but only when valve 3 is closed.
- the bypass 12 permanently open could be doubled with a discharge pipe of larger diameter and which can be opened when the valve 3 is closed to increase the speed of evacuation from the tank 6.
